Titan is the first script to introduce global support to all Offer Walls and CPA/GPT Networks. After it's properly installed and configured, you can use any Offer Wall with no extra management. All postbacks (see Postbacks) are handled 100% automatically.
We can't automatically add all Offer Walls ready-to-go to the script for one simple reason: every Offer Wall configuration is unique and it depends on the account you create in every Offer Wall provider. That is why we wrote tutorial how to integrate each Offer Wall provider into your Titan script.
Universal installation process
Yoy need to complete this process for every Offer Wall you want to install.
Create new Offer Wall
Go to Admin Panel / CPA/GPT / Offer Walls / Add new and click "Add new, empty Offer Wall" button. After you click the button, you should see a success message and be redirected to Installed Offerwalls within 10 seconds. You should now see your newly created Offer Wall as "Awaiting setup..". Activate it (see Activating, pausing and deleting Offer Walls).
Edit the Offer Wall
In Admin Panel / CPA/GPT / Offer Walls / Installed Offerwall click "See details and edit" button. You will now see Offer Wall summary page. To edit its settings, click "Edit Offer Wall" in the panel to the left.
Create the Offer Wall in the Offer Wall provider website
Open a new tab. Go to your Offer Wall provider website and create an account there. Next log into your accout, and add new Offer Wall/application there. Fill in all details and save.
Offer Wall HTML
Find your Offer Wall HTML on Offer Wall provider website and return to your Titan Admin Panel Offer Wall. Paste your Offer Wall HTML code into "HTML code" field. Make sure to replace current member username with [USERNAME] variable. Full list of supported variables can be found below:
Variable | Description | Required |
---|---|---|
[USERNAME] | Username of currently logged in member | Yes |
[REGISTERED] | Registration date of the member (unix timestamp) | No |
[EMAIL] | Email of the member | No |
[AGE] | Age of the member | No |
[GENDER] | Gender of the member ('M', 'F' or 'U' if unknown) | No |
You can alternatively use %% instead of [], for example %USERNAME% will work the same as [USERNAME].

Postback URL
Copy-paste your Postback URL from Titan Admin Panel to your Offer Wall provider website.
Restrict Postback IPs (optional)
For better security, it is recommended to restrict IP addresses that have access to your postback handler. Find IP addresses of your Offer Wall provider in their documentation (if there are any) and copy-paste them into "Whitelisted IPs" field. Make sure to check "Restrict Postback IPs" checkbox.
